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Penge West to Whitwell (Derbyshire) start from as little as £17.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Penge West to Whitwell (Derbyshire) start from £57.20 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Penge West to Whitwell (Derbyshire) are available for £116.20 one way

Facilities at Penge West

Penge West is designed with traveler convenience in mind. Ticketing services are readily available with opening hours from 07:00 to 10:00 on weekdays, and ticket machines are accessible for easy collection of tickets bought online. Its commitment to accessibility is evident with features like an induction loop and step-free access to the ticket office and platform 1. However, travelers should note the footbridge with steps leading to platform 2. For a more fully accessible journey, Anerley, the closest step-free station, is your best bet.

While the station does not offer waiting rooms or car parking spaces, it compensates with open seating areas and bicycle storage for those cycling to the station. Despite the absence of shops and refreshment facilities, the station remains vigilant with CCTV surveillance to ensure safety. Staying connected is effortless with public Wi-Fi services—explore your options or plan your next stops at any time.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Despite its modest size, Whitwell (Derbyshire) station offers a good range of facilities to ensure a hassle-free journey. Although there is no ticket office, travellers can easily purchase and collect tickets from accessible machines. The station supports smartcards with the available validators, though it's worth noting smartcards cannot be issued at the station itself.

For those requiring assistance, a help point is available, alongside customer help points to guide you through your travel needs. CCTV is active, ensuring security throughout your visit. Accessibility features are a key aspect here, with step-free access to platform 1, while platform 2 is accessible via a ramped footbridge, all while offering tactile paving at platform edges.
